[0050] Phage liquid Stability verification test.

[0051] Enrichment of phages as described above After enrichment, centrifuge at 8000rpm for 5min, filter through a 0.22μm filter membrane, and take 1 mL of the filtrate was dispensed into 40 2 mL centrifuge tubes under aseptic conditions, and the centrifuge tubes were divided into four groups and stored at room temperature, 4°C, -20°C, and -80°C. And at 30d, 60d, and 90d, the potency was determined by double-plate method. see results image 3 .

[0052] Depend on image 3 It can be seen that the survival rate of phage is the lowest when stored at room temperature and -80°C. After 90 days of storage, the phage The survival rates are 3.4% and 11%, respectively, and it is not recommended for long-term storage; when stored at 4°C and -20°C, the preservation effect of phage is relatively good, and the preservation effect at 4°C is the best. Abstract

The invention relates to a freeze-drying protective agent for klebsiella pneumoniae bacteriophage and a preparation method and application of the agent. The klebsiella pneumoniae bacteriophage phi YSZKA is involved, the preservation number is CCTCC M 2018513, and the klebsiella pneumoniae bacteriophage is named as Klebsiella phage phi YSZKA through classification. The freeze-drying protective agent is prepared from, by mass, 50 parts of skimmed milk powder, 30 parts of tryptone, 10 parts of glucose, 20 parts of sucrose, 1 part of anhydrous magnesium sulfate, 2 parts of gelatin and 1.5 parts ofglycerinum. The bacteriophage is subjected to vacuum freezing by adding the freeze-drying agent, and freeze-dried powder is placed in a top empty bottle for storage at the normal temperature or 4 DEGC. After the freeze-dried powder is preserved for 90 days, the survival rate of the freeze-dried powder is higher than or equal to 90%, and an optimal selection method for strain storage is providedfor transportation and application of a bacteriophage therapy in the fields such as agriculture, medical treatment, food and environments.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the technical field of phage freeze-drying, in particular to a Klebsiella pneumoniae phage (Klebsiella phage ) lyoprotectant and its preparation method and application. Background technique [0002] Klebsiella pneumoniae (Klebsiella.Peneumoniae) is a pathogenic bacterium that widely exists in the natural environment, and it is easy to cause iatrogenic infection to the elderly, infants and other people with low immunity. Klebsiella pneumoniae is a short and thick bacillus, arranged alone, in pairs or in short chains, without spores, without flagella, with thicker capsules, most of which have pili, and mainly exists in the human intestine Tract, respiratory tract, can cause bronchitis, pneumonia, urinary system and trauma infection, and even sepsis, meningitis, peritonitis and so on.
